Srinagar, Nov 13: In wake of ensuing winter season, the Deputy Commissioner (DC) Srinagar, Dr Bilal Mohi-Ud-Din Bhat today chaired a meeting to review power scenario to ensure adequate electricity supply in the District.

At the outset, the DC reviewed the progress under CSS-RDSS Scheme, PM Surya Ghar, Muft bijli Yojana, buffer stock availability of transformers and other related issues including winter Preparedness.

While reviewing the Curtailment Schedule and Power availability to the consumers, the DC asked the concerned to ensure power supply is available to consumers strictly as per the already notified curtailment schedule and adequate arrangements are in place to meet the power demand of 450-500 MW of power in Srinagar City.

Like wise, the DC stressed that adequate buffer stock of transformers should be available in all Divisional Stores which includes availability of Key Material like Distribution transformers, ST poles, Conductor etc to meet any eventuality in case of outages caused due to harsh weather conditions.

Moreover, the damaged DT shall be replaced and power supply to the area restored within the stipulated timeline.

With regard to progress made under RDSS, The chair expressed concern over low progress achieved in one of the divisions and directed the executing agencies carrying out reforms works under RDSS in to speed up the works so that the set target is achieved within the stipulated timeline.

During the meeting, the PM Surya Ghar and Muft Bijli Yojana also came to discussion and the chair was informed that out of the total 3725 applications received in PMS:MBY, 859 were from Srinagar District out of which 156 installations have been completed.

The Department was asked to encourage and facilitate the consumers to install the Roof Top Solar system which will go a long way ensuring the reliability of power, capacity building, environmental friendly generation, besides reduced electricity bills.Among others, the meeting was attended by SE Cr-II, KPDCL, Shurjeel Ghani Lala, SE Projects KPDCL, Nisar Ahmed Lone, Xen ED-I, Majeed Salroo, Xen ED-III, Firdous Ahmed, Xen TLMD-I, KPTCL, Ajay Puri, and AEEs.
